Get started10 Jersey Road is a three-bedroom semi-detached house in Maldon (CM9 5JH). It has a recorded floor area of 72 m² (around 775 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1950-1966 and council tax band A. The latest certificate (December 2024) shows a D (score 67), on the cusp of jumping into the C band. The rating has held steady at D across 3 certificates since July 2009. Between certificates, roof efficiency went from Average to Good; while wall efficiency dropped from Average to Poor. The recommended improvements would lift it to B (score 86), a 2-band jump. Other recorded features include a conservatory.
Untraded for 18 years, with the last transfer in March 2008. That sale landed at the peak of the pre-credit-crunch market, which is a useful reference point when interpreting the price. Sale prices here have outpaced Maldon HPI: 16.8% per year against 0% for the wider region. Today's modelled estimate of £282,000 sits 91.8% above the 2008 sale of £147,000. On a £-per-square-foot basis, the last sale (£190/sq ft) was about 30% below the postcode norm.
